 | | G.I. Joe Valor Vs. Venom New Case Assortment At KB Toys | | Posted on 05-08-2008 at 02:32 PM by DESTRO | Social Bookmarks | RSS Feeds | New Case assortment of G.I. Joe Valor Vs. Venom are starting to show up at KB Toys. The case assortment is: Baroness x2, Storm Shadow x4, Snake Eyes x4, Tele-Vipers x2, Night Creeper x2, Sand Viper x2, Sgt. Stalker x2, Ace x2, Dusty x2 and KamaKura x2.
The listed retail price is $3.98 per figure.
